手机变Linux终端:探索手机端运行Linux命令和SSH连接手机
2023-11-29 13:09:10
在移动互联网时代,我们的手机早已不仅仅是通讯工具,更是一个功能强大的迷你计算机。而随着技术的不断发展,如今我们甚至可以在手机上运行Linux命令,并通过SSH远程连接管理手机,实现更灵活、更强大的操作体验。
手机端运行Linux命令
1. Termux:手机上的Linux终端模拟器
Termux是一个功能强大的Android终端模拟器,它可以在手机上创建一个类似Linux的命令行环境,用户可以在其中运行各种Linux命令,包括bash、python、git等。Termux无需root权限,安装方便,使用简单。
2. 安装Termux并运行命令
首先,在Google Play商店或F-Droid中安装Termux。安装完成后,打开Termux,就可以看到一个类似于Linux终端的界面。在命令提示符下,可以输入各种Linux命令,如ls、cd、mkdir、apt等。
3. 运行示例命令
例如,输入以下命令创建并切换到一个名为“test”的目录:
mkdir test
cd test
然后,输入以下命令创建一个名为“hello.txt”的文件:
touch hello.txt
4. 安装其他软件包
Termux还可以安装其他软件包,如编辑器、编译器、开发工具等。例如,要安装Vim编辑器,可以输入以下命令:
pkg install vim
SSH连接手机
1. 开启手机SSH服务
为了通过SSH远程连接手机,需要先开启手机的SSH服务。Termux提供了一个名为“sshd”的SSH服务,可以轻松启用。在Termux中输入以下命令:
sshd
2. 配置SSH连接
在电脑上使用SSH客户端(如PuTTY或OpenSSH)连接手机。输入手机的IP地址(可以使用“ifconfig”命令查看)和端口号(默认22),并输入Termux中显示的用户名和密码。
3. 远程管理手机
连接成功后,就可以在电脑上远程管理手机。可以使用各种Linux命令对手机进行操作,如查看文件、安装软件、启动服务等。例如,要查看手机中的文件,可以输入以下命令:
ls /sdcard
活用手机端Linux命令和SSH连接
1. 提升手机生产力
通过运行Linux命令和SSH连接手机,可以提升手机的生产力,进行一些以前只能在电脑上完成的操作,如代码编辑、编译、文件管理、系统配置等。
2. 远程访问手机
SSH连接使你可以从任何地方远程访问手机,即使手机不在身边。这在需要从其他设备访问手机文件、调试问题或管理应用程序时非常有用。
3. 自定义手机功能
Linux命令和SSH连接提供了高度的自定义性,允许用户根据自己的需要定制手机功能。例如,可以创建脚本来自动执行任务、安装自定义软件或修改系统设置。